FAQs
How does this integrate with our existing cafeteria operation?
Reusables is designed to fit into existing hospital cafeteria and grab-and-go workflows without disrupting service or requiring changes to your line setup. Return stations are placed at natural traffic points and containers flow back into your existing dishwashing process. No new POS systems, staff tracking, or workflow changes required.
If you have leftover containers from a previous program, we can integrate them into the system at no additional charge.
Are the containers safe for a healthcare environment?
Yes. All containers are commercial food service grade — BPA-free, dishwasher-safe to institutional standards, and rated for 500+ wash cycles without degrading. The closed-loop system is designed to meet the hygiene standards of high-traffic institutional food service operations.
How do staff and visitors check out containers?
Staff check out containers using their existing employee badge or ID — no new accounts or steps required. Visitors and patients can use standard credit or debit at the point of sale. The experience is frictionless regardless of who's in line.
What containers does Reusables use?
Reusables is container agnostic — the system works with virtually any reusable format, including stainless steel, BPA-free plastic, microwaveable, and non-microwaveable options. For institutions that want a turnkey solution, we supply high-quality commercial-grade containers available by lease or purchase. If you already own containers, those work too.
